Frequently asked questions

  • What license do I need to apply?

    An active state license in your discipline (PT, OT, SLP, LCSW, LPC, BCBA, etc.) in good standing. Therapy licensure is state-specific — the PT, OT, and ASLP-IC compacts let you practice in member states without a separate license.

  • Is this a school-year or year-round position?

    School-based therapy roles typically follow a 9- or 10-month school-year calendar with summers off. Outpatient, hospital, home-health, and telehealth positions are year-round with PTO. Both options are widely available — check the job description for specifics.

  • What experience is expected?

    Most therapy roles welcome new grads through mid-career clinicians. Specialty positions (acute care, NICU, pediatric feeding, hand therapy) typically prefer 2+ years plus relevant certifications.

Full Job Details

Premiere Healthcare Staffing is seeking a dedicated and compassionate Physical Therapist to join our Healthcare & Medical Services team, supporting Premier Health & Safety’s mission to deliver high-quality health and safety training and care.

In this role, you will evaluate, plan, and implement evidence-based physical therapy interventions for patients recovering from injury, surgery, or managing chronic conditions, with a strong emphasis on functional mobility, pain reduction, and safe return to work and daily activities.

You will perform comprehensive assessments, develop individualized treatment plans, and provide hands-on therapies including therapeutic exercise, manual therapy, neuromuscular re-education, and modalities as appropriate.

Collaboration is central to this position: you will work closely with physicians, nurses, case managers, and health and safety trainers to ensure continuity of care and adherence to best practices and regulatory standards.

Documentation of patient assessments, progress notes, treatment outcomes, and discharge plans must be timely, accurate, and compliant with regulatory and payer requirements.

As part of an organization focused on health and safety, you will also contribute to employee and client education by teaching proper body mechanics, ergonomics, injury prevention, and safe workplace practices, occasionally participating in or supporting training sessions and workshops.

You will mentor and guide support staff such as physical therapist assistants and aides, ensuring care is delivered consistently and safely.
